The ELSRV1 stabilizers supply a constant voltage, correcting voltage drops and increases that occur on the network or in the internal structure of the electrical system.
Our voltage regulators work automatically to regulate voltage without any user intervention.
Once the regulator is turned on, the mains voltage is continuously measured and the necessary raise/lower operations are performed automatically, providing the system with the constant voltage required for correct operation.
Servo regulators consist of a variator, a servomotor that controls the variator, a multimeter with electronic management that controls the motor and the booster transformer.
The motor’s high torque corrects quickly thanks to the DC servo motor and control system that can quickly respond to voltage changes.
When the regulation is completed, the servomotor is de-energized with an electronic braking circuit.

OPERATING TECHNOLOGY
Single-phase electromechanical voltage stabilizers use a toroidal transformer (variable transformer), a BUCK-BOOST transformer, and an electronic circuit that controls the rotation of the variable transformer, thus regulating the output voltage. With the control system, in a very fast response time, the high-torque regulation motor regulates small voltage changes very quickly. The servomotor is put out of service by the limit switches when it is outside its operating limits and by the control circuit when the output voltage is automatically adjusted to the set value. When the regulation is complete, the motor’s energy is cut with the help of an electronic opening circuit, operating in complete silence.
REGULATION SYSTEM
The system is equipped with a bypass switch that allows the load to be powered with mains voltage in the event of a malfunction or need. Using the setting buttons you can adjust the output voltage, precision range, regulation speed, and high-low voltage limits. It is then possible to adjust the maximum current control and the relative hysteresis time. All settings can be password protected. A display shows the input and output voltage, and the current delivered.
